Cant Projection Regions

Displayed when there are projected regions in the cant range. Each row in the table displays one cant projection range.

Cant projection is point based and, in a cant object some points can be projected while others are calculated based on curvature.

Cant projection can create projected points, if there is no point, or projected values if there is already a point to update. This is represented with different decorations in the dynamics. In the below example you can see that in the right location there is already a spiral point on the projection location, so when cant is projected, only the value of this point is updated. Whereas in the right location, there is no existing point on the projection geometry, but there is one in the source cant, so a new point will be created on the projected region.
